Omron E3S Series Photoelectric Sensor, 100mm to 300mm Detection Range, NPN Output - E3SR12


This photoelectric sensor, designed for industrial applications, features a compact block style. Incorporating a PBT housing, it operates effectively in diverse environments with an IP67 rating, ensuring durability against dust and moisture. With a detection range of 100mm to 300mm, it is ideal for sensing transparent objects, such as glass and plastic bottles. The device utilises an infrared LED as its light source and supports a maximum current of 100mA with an NPN output.

How does the response time impact performance in fast-paced environments?


A response time of 1ms allows the device to quickly detect the presence of objects, making it suitable for high-speed applications where timing is crucial, enhancing overall throughput.

What should be considered when integrating the sensor with existing systems?


Ensure that the sensor’s NPN output aligns with the system requirements, and verify that the power supply falls within the 10 to 30 VDC range to prevent overheating or damage to the unit.

How does the IP67 rating influence the sensor's usability in tough conditions?


An IP67 rating signifies robust protection against dust and immersion in water, making the sensor reliable for use in harsh environments like factories, where exposure to elements can compromise other sensors.

What materials can this sensor effectively detect without issues?


It is designed specifically for transparent objects like glass and plastic, but variations in material thickness and shape might affect its performance, emphasising the need for testing before application.
